// Client setup for the Ovenlane ordering service.
// Business rule: custom cake orders must be placed before 14:00
// local time, two days ahead; the cutoff check happens server-side,
// so never duplicate it here or the two clocks will drift apart.
// The client below authenticates against the internal Ovenlane
// cutoff API using the key on the next line.

gateway credential: kto23_LX9A4ys6i4nzHtpOLNLodKK

### v4.7.2 — Heads up, support folks

We renamed `RATECACHE_TTL` to `TAXRATE_CACHE_TTL` in the Dunmow lookup service, so old env files will silently fall back to defaults. Tell customers to update their config when they complain about stale rates. The cache warmer also needs its upstream credential, added right after this line.

vault entry, yahif-yajep: COURIER_KEY29=b802bdf8034096b65a51c6ba5abe2

Subject: Drone returned for servicing

Hi dispatch team,

Unit K-14 from the Fennwick Surveyor fleet came back this morning with a faulty rotor mount. It's been tagged, logged, and crated for transfer to the Orvale repair depot on Thursday's run. Battery removed and stored separately per standard practice. The courier will collect the crate from Bay 3. Please pass the following hand-over instruction to the courier on arrival:

handover note for hafop-bagug: the holok frair courier leaves the rusvan novmir eliix gilath oliiel kasix eliax wenmir ledger at gate 3383 under passcode 753647

Handover note — Crumbwheel order cutoffs.

Welcome aboard. The bakery cutoff rule in Crumbwheel closes same-day orders at 14:00 local to each storefront, not UTC — this has bitten us twice. Holiday overrides live in the calendar service and take precedence silently, so always check there first when a cutoff looks wrong. To unlock the calendar service's admin console after a restart, enter the recovery passphrase below.

vault phrase of bagap-bahaf = silion-pelox-sorox-casdor-quenwyn-fraax-eliox-praael-kelion-quenvan-kasox-rusael-norius-belvan

ALERT: Config hot-reload failure — Penumbra service. The watcher detected a config change but reload did not complete within 60s; the service is running on stale settings. Do not restart blindly — check for a malformed YAML push from Driftgate first. Validation output and recovery steps are documented on the internal page below.

operations page: https://vault.qorvelcorp.example/settings